Cucurbit

Cucurbits are a family of vegetables that include squash, pumpkins, and gourds, known for their high water content and low calorie count, making them a great addition to a healthy diet.

Rich in antioxidants, cucurbits help combat oxidative stress and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
High water content aids in hydration and supports digestive health.

Aloe Vera

Aloe Vera is a succulent plant known for its soothing properties and high water content, making it a popular choice for hydration and skin care.

Aloe Vera is rich in antioxidants and vitamins, which help to combat oxidative stress and support overall skin health.
It has anti-inflammatory properties that can aid in reducing skin irritation and promoting healing.
